Sweepstakes Offers Luxurious Prize Package
The 14th annual Hawai'i Food & Wine Festival (HFWF) has announced an exciting sweepstakes, offering one lucky winner a grand prize valued at over ,000. The prize package includes 160,000 HawaiianMiles for travel on Hawaiian Airlines, a four-night stay in an ocean view room at the Sheraton Maui Resort & Spa, two Priority Access tickets to the Vita La Vino grand tasting, and a five-day luxury vehicle rental through Go Rentals on Maui. The 14th annual Hawai'i Food & Wine Festival is a testament to the resilience of the local community. Last year, the festival organizers raised and distributed over .2 million in relief funds for more than 1,200 restaurant, bar, and hospitality workers in Maui through the nonprofit organization's Kokua Restaurant & Hospitality Fund, following the devastating wildfires that impacted the region. The Hawai'i Food & Wine Festival is scheduled for three weekends of events across three islands, from October 18 to November 10, 2024. The October 25 through October 27 events will mark the festival's return to Kā'anapali Beach Resort, providing attendees with the opportunity to immerse themselves in the beautiful beaches, rich cultural heritage, and vibrant culinary scene of Maui.
